What Emotion Code Is About

From my understanding, Emotion Code is a healing approach created by Bradley Nelson that focuses on identifying and releasing trapped emotions. I found the concept interesting because it aims to help people address emotional burdens that may affect their well-being. What stood out to me was that it is presented as a self-help tool, which made it feel more accessible and personal.
